JAL and ANA to Reduce Fuel Surcharges to Below ¥60,000 for U.S. and Europe Flights

- Japan Airlines (JAL) and All Nippon Airways (ANA) have announced a reduction in fuel surcharges for flights to the U.S. and Europe, lowering the fee to below ¥60,000.
- This change comes after both airlines had previously raised the surcharges to a record ¥65,000 for tickets issued in July and August. The adjustment reflects ongoing fluctuations in fuel prices and aims to make international travel more accessible.
- Fuel surcharges are a common practice among airlines to offset fluctuating fuel costs, which can significantly impact profitability. The recent adjustments by JAL and ANA highlight the ongoing volatility in the aviation industry, particularly as global travel patterns evolve.
- The decision to cut fuel surcharges is a strategic move by JAL and ANA to remain competitive in a challenging travel market. By lowering these costs, the airlines may attract more passengers, especially as travel demand continues to recover post-pandemic.
